Kerry Washington Just Debuted a Dramatic Jellyfish Bob—See Pics

The jellyfish cut is one of the trendiest, edgiest ways to wear layers. “It’s a ‘half short, half long’ mullet style,” Raven Hurtado, stylist at Maxine Salon, told Glamour in August. “The jellyfish cut has disconnected sections, with the top section [having] very short layers while the bottom layer is long and textured.” The top section is short and rounded, resembling a short bob or a bowl cut, while the longer layers resemble tentacles, which is how it got its “jellyfish” name.
